On August 18th, BYD and Alexander Dennis Limited (ADL) jointly announced the delivery of the first three-axle BYD ADL Enviro200EV XLB. Built locally by ADL's partner Kiwi Bus Builders on a BYD chassis, the delivery fully supports New Zealand's transition to a decarbonised bus fleet by 2035. Joining the Auckland Transport fleet, the zero-emission bus will be evaluated in New Zealand's largest city on trials sponsored by Mercury Energy.
This 41-foot-long (12.5m) electric bus has three axles and provides a total passenger capacity of 78 ensuring operational flexibility. Additionally, 36 passengers can be seated, and two wheelchair spaces are provided which are accessed via a manual ramp at the front door.
